Pilgrimages are gaining popularity, with new routes like the Golden Valley Pilgrim Way in Herefordshire offering peaceful walking or cycling experiences. Meanwhile, Bannau Brycheiniog in Wales emphasizes Welsh culture, native tree planting, and eco-friendly tourism. … Continue readingBEST HOLIDAY DESTINATIONS 2024 – ‘Divine Herefordshire’ and ‘Bannau Brycheiniog’ named as the best places to visit in The Times and The New York Times

This post recommends various local pubs, highlighting their unique qualities and charm. The Cornewall Arms offers a rustic, friendly atmosphere; the Carpenters Arms serves traditional ales and food; The Crown focuses on Welsh produce; The Kilpeck Inn blends history with contemporary dining; The Moody Cow provides superb hospitality; The Bell Inn offers award-winning cuisine; The Temple Bar Inn changes with the seasons; and the Bridge Inn features riverside dining. … Continue readingBEST LOCAL PUBS – Our favourite country pubs in Herefordshire and Moumouthshire
